Instructions:
1. First, apply a cotton swab soaked in Vaseline to the blackheads on your nose.
2. Next, cover your nose with plastic wrap to create a barrier.
3. Dip a cotton towel in warm water, wring it out, and apply it to your nose. Hold it for about 30 seconds to a minute.
4. Carefully remove the plastic wrap from your nose. Gently use a cotton swab to remove any remaining Vaseline from the tip of your nose.
